Crisp Cube, released in 2021, is an engaging action puzzle game that challenges players to think strategically while clearing cubes to survive. Players must place triggers on tiles and activate them thoughtfully to avoid collapsing into the black void below. Its unique blend of action and strategy, combined with a minimalistic aesthetic, sets it apart in the puzzle genre, creating an experience that is both relaxing and mentally stimulating.
